Understanding the 2010 Hyundai Elantra Stereo Wiring Diagram
The 2010 Hyundai Elantra Stereo Wiring Diagram is essentially a technical blueprint that details every wire connected to your car's factory stereo system. It illustrates the color coding and function of each wire, making it clear which wires carry power, ground, speaker signals, and data for other vehicle systems. This diagram is invaluable for anyone looking to personalize their car's sound experience.
These diagrams are used for several important purposes:
- Installation of Aftermarket Stereos: When replacing the factory head unit with an aftermarket one, the wiring diagram helps match the wires from the new stereo to the correct wires in the Elantra's harness. This ensures proper power, speaker output, and accessory functions.
- Adding Amplifiers and Subwoofers: For more complex audio setups, the diagram identifies the best points to tap into for power, ground, and audio signals to feed an external amplifier.
- Troubleshooting Audio Problems: If a speaker isn't working, or if the stereo is experiencing power issues, the wiring diagram is the first place to look to diagnose the problem and identify faulty connections or components.
Here's a simplified look at what you might find on a typical 2010 Hyundai Elantra Stereo Wiring Diagram:
| Wire Color | Function |
|---|---|
| Yellow | Constant Power (12V+) |
| Red | Accessory Power (Switched 12V+) |
| Black | Ground |
| Blue | Power Antenna / Remote Turn-On |
| White | Left Front Speaker Positive (+) |
| White/Black | Left Front Speaker Negative (-) |
| Gray | Right Front Speaker Positive (+) |
| Gray/Black | Right Front Speaker Negative (-) |
| Green | Left Rear Speaker Positive (+) |
| Green/Black | Left Rear Speaker Negative (-) |
| Purple | Right Rear Speaker Positive (+) |
| Purple/Black | Right Rear Speaker Negative (-) |
